Sorocaba has a population of 762,172, making it the 24th largest place we list in Brazil. It is in São Paulo.
Sorocaba holds 0.36% of Brazil's 213,562,666 people. São Paulo, the largest place we list there, is 16 times its size. Twenty years earlier the World Gazetteer recorded 558,862, a rise of 36%.
The 2005 figure comes from the World Gazetteer archive restored on this site. The two sources may draw the settlement's boundary differently, so treat the change as indicative rather than exact. Why figures differ.
